There is pressing need to accurately and meaningfully capture depression in clinical practice. However, despite being readily available for study by virtue of its seeming ubiquity, researchers have struggled to provide significant advances that inform our understanding of depression and improve its clinical management.
In this lecture, I will discuss how we should perhaps redefine depression and in doing so propose an approach that is likely to provide a more precise and meaningful diagnosis.
